Output f63ae88039282595b6933400493eb24cc124537770d48abb29859649546d91e9:0

value
581280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ba326483ce799991068f795f2e2cb5a233bd673 OP_EQUALVERIFY OP_CHECKSIG
address
13X8h1UVwc88cvtJxfSEBLTnagLcqS7Ekh
transaction
f63ae88039282595b6933400493eb24cc124537770d48abb29859649546d91e9
spent
true